Beyond conversion, a strong configurator reduces operational drag by standardizing how options are selected. When the system validates compatibility—like finishes that match materials or accessories that fit specific models—fewer orders require manual review. The result is lower error rates, fewer customer support tickets, and faster fulfillment cycles. A benefits-led approach means focusing on what customers gain: speed, confidence, and products that match their needs.
Deliver a 3D Experience That Builds Confidence
Visual clarity is one of the biggest drivers of purchase confidence in configurable catalogs. A 3d product configurator ecommerce experience lets customers rotate, preview, and compare options in context. When buyers can see how color, texture, 3d product configurator ecommerce and components change together, they make decisions faster and with fewer doubts. This is especially valuable for products where small differences matter, such as eyewear, furniture, signage, and premium electronics accessories.
Interactivity also supports upsell and cross-sell without being pushy. If a shopper can instantly preview premium upgrades—like upgraded materials, additional features, or special engraving—they’re more likely to choose higher-value configurations. The configurator can highlight best-sellers, recommended bundles, or limited options while keeping selection simple. That blend of guidance and freedom makes the product feel tailored rather than constrained.
Connect Design Choices to Production with Confidence
Customization only wins when the selected configuration turns into a buildable, shippable product. Modern product configuration workflows link customer selections to rules, pricing logic, and manufacturing requirements. This prevents the common disconnect where front-end choices don’t align with back-end capabilities. As a result, you maintain consistency across every order and protect margins with accurate, automated pricing.
It also helps scale personalization without scaling chaos. Configuration data can feed into manufacturing planning so on-demand production starts with the right specifications. That reduces rework and enables smoother handoffs between design, operations, and fulfillment teams. When customers receive the exact result they envisioned, you build trust that supports repeat purchases and brand loyalty.
